Add icons to this collection by clicking the heart icon.
Hard Disk icon - also known as data, storage, currency, money, Mining, electronics, database, hard disk, bitcoin, business and finance, and cryptocurrency. Created in a clean gradient style, perfect for web, apps, and UI projects. Available in SVG and PNG, with multiple style variants.
<svg
xmlns="http://www.w3.org/2000/svg"
width="100"
height="100"
viewBox="0 0 480 480"
>
<linearGradient
id="a"
x1="-26.875"
x2="-26.875"
y1="619.958"
y2="557.955"
gradientTransform="matrix(8 0 0 -8 455 4941)"
gradientUnits="userSpaceOnUse"
>
<stop offset="0" stop-color="#fff33b" />
<stop offset=".04" stop-color="#fee72e" />
<stop offset=".117" stop-color="#fed51b" />
<stop offset=".196" stop-color="#fdca10" />
<stop offset=".281" stop-color="#fdc70c" />
<stop offset=".669" stop-color="#f3903f" />
<stop offset=".888" stop-color="#ed683c" />
<stop offset="1" stop-color="#e93e3a" />
</linearGradient>
<path
d="M408 0H72a8 8 0 0 0-8 8v464a8 8 0 0 0 8 8h336a8 8 0 0 0 8-8V8a8 8 0 0 0-8-8zm-8 464H80V16h320v448z"
fill="url(#a)"
/>
<linearGradient
id="b"
x1="-26.875"
x2="-26.875"
y1="619.958"
y2="557.955"
gradientTransform="matrix(8 0 0 -8 455 4941)"
gradientUnits="userSpaceOnUse"
>
<stop offset="0" stop-color="#fff33b" />
<stop offset=".04" stop-color="#fee72e" />
<stop offset=".117" stop-color="#fed51b" />
<stop offset=".196" stop-color="#fdca10" />
<stop offset=".281" stop-color="#fdc70c" />
<stop offset=".669" stop-color="#f3903f" />
<stop offset=".888" stop-color="#ed683c" />
<stop offset="1" stop-color="#e93e3a" />
</linearGradient>
<path
d="M337.696 221.32a8.065 8.065 0 0 1-1.24-8.8 7.64 7.64 0 0 1 7.16-4.52H344c13.255 0 24-10.745 24-24v-48c0-13.255-10.745-24-24-24H136c-13.255 0-24 10.745-24 24v48c.065 13.321 10.917 24.067 24.238 24.001l.162-.001a7.904 7.904 0 0 1 7.288 4.68 7.72 7.72 0 0 1-1.128 8.336c-45.831 53.823-39.352 134.609 14.472 180.44A128 128 0 0 0 239.928 432c2 0 4-.048 6.04-.144 65.288-3.517 117.626-55.312 121.824-120.56a127.585 127.585 0 0 0-30.096-89.976zm14.128 89.08c-3.672 57.089-49.467 102.407-106.592 105.48-61.789 2.88-114.213-44.876-117.092-106.665a112.002 112.002 0 0 1 26.596-77.815 23.552 23.552 0 0 0 3.48-25.424A23.944 23.944 0 0 0 136 192a8 8 0 0 1-8-8v-48a8 8 0 0 1 8-8h208a8 8 0 0 1 8 8v48a8 8 0 0 1-8 8h-.384a23.633 23.633 0 0 0-21.68 13.808 24 24 0 0 0 3.56 25.856 111.672 111.672 0 0 1 26.328 78.736z"
fill="url(#b)"
/>
<linearGradient
id="c"
x1="-26.875"
x2="-26.875"
y1="619.958"
y2="557.955"
gradientTransform="matrix(8 0 0 -8 455 4941)"
gradientUnits="userSpaceOnUse"
>
<stop offset="0" stop-color="#fff33b" />
<stop offset=".04" stop-color="#fee72e" />
<stop offset=".117" stop-color="#fed51b" />
<stop offset=".196" stop-color="#fdca10" />
<stop offset=".281" stop-color="#fdc70c" />
<stop offset=".669" stop-color="#f3903f" />
<stop offset=".888" stop-color="#ed683c" />
<stop offset="1" stop-color="#e93e3a" />
</linearGradient>
<path d="M176 160h128a8 8 0 0 0 0-16H176a8 8 0 0 0 0 16z" fill="url(#c)" />
<linearGradient
id="d"
x1="-26.875"
x2="-26.875"
y1="619.958"
y2="557.955"
gradientTransform="matrix(8 0 0 -8 455 4941)"
gradientUnits="userSpaceOnUse"
>
<stop offset="0" stop-color="#fff33b" />
<stop offset=".04" stop-color="#fee72e" />
<stop offset=".117" stop-color="#fed51b" />
<stop offset=".196" stop-color="#fdca10" />
<stop offset=".281" stop-color="#fdc70c" />
<stop offset=".669" stop-color="#f3903f" />
<stop offset=".888" stop-color="#ed683c" />
<stop offset="1" stop-color="#e93e3a" />
</linearGradient>
<path d="M176 192h128a8 8 0 0 0 0-16H176a8 8 0 0 0 0 16z" fill="url(#d)" />
<linearGradient
id="e"
x1="-26.375"
x2="-26.375"
y1="619.958"
y2="557.955"
gradientTransform="matrix(8 0 0 -8 455 4941)"
gradientUnits="userSpaceOnUse"
>
<stop offset="0" stop-color="#fff33b" />
<stop offset=".04" stop-color="#fee72e" />
<stop offset=".117" stop-color="#fed51b" />
<stop offset=".196" stop-color="#fdca10" />
<stop offset=".281" stop-color="#fdc70c" />
<stop offset=".669" stop-color="#f3903f" />
<stop offset=".888" stop-color="#ed683c" />
<stop offset="1" stop-color="#e93e3a" />
</linearGradient>
<path
d="M276.8 299.768A23.746 23.746 0 0 0 280 288c0-13.255-10.745-24-24-24v-8a8 8 0 0 0-16 0v8h-8v-8a8 8 0 0 0-16 0v8h-8a8 8 0 0 0 0 16h8v48h-8a8 8 0 0 0 0 16h8v8a8 8 0 0 0 16 0v-8h8v8a8 8 0 0 0 16 0v-8h8c13.228.031 23.977-10.668 24.008-23.896a23.954 23.954 0 0 0-11.208-20.336zM264 288a8 8 0 0 1-8 8h-24v-16h24a8 8 0 0 1 8 8zm0 40h-32v-16h32a8 8 0 0 1 0 16z"
fill="url(#e)"
/>
<linearGradient
id="f"
x1="-26.875"
x2="-26.875"
y1="619.958"
y2="557.955"
gradientTransform="matrix(8 0 0 -8 455 4941)"
gradientUnits="userSpaceOnUse"
>
<stop offset="0" stop-color="#fff33b" />
<stop offset=".04" stop-color="#fee72e" />
<stop offset=".117" stop-color="#fed51b" />
<stop offset=".196" stop-color="#fdca10" />
<stop offset=".281" stop-color="#fdc70c" />
<stop offset=".669" stop-color="#f3903f" />
<stop offset=".888" stop-color="#ed683c" />
<stop offset="1" stop-color="#e93e3a" />
</linearGradient>
<path
d="M240 224c-44.183 0-80 35.817-80 80s35.817 80 80 80 80-35.817 80-80c-.048-44.163-35.837-79.952-80-80zm0 144c-35.346 0-64-28.654-64-64s28.654-64 64-64 64 28.654 64 64c-.04 35.33-28.67 63.96-64 64z"
fill="url(#f)"
/>
<linearGradient
id="g"
x1="-41.875"
x2="-41.875"
y1="619.958"
y2="557.955"
gradientTransform="matrix(8 0 0 -8 455 4941)"
gradientUnits="userSpaceOnUse"
>
<stop offset="0" stop-color="#fff33b" />
<stop offset=".04" stop-color="#fee72e" />
<stop offset=".117" stop-color="#fed51b" />
<stop offset=".196" stop-color="#fdca10" />
<stop offset=".281" stop-color="#fdc70c" />
<stop offset=".669" stop-color="#f3903f" />
<stop offset=".888" stop-color="#ed683c" />
<stop offset="1" stop-color="#e93e3a" />
</linearGradient>
<path
d="M120 80c13.255 0 24-10.745 24-24s-10.745-24-24-24-24 10.745-24 24 10.745 24 24 24zm0-32a8 8 0 1 1 0 16 8 8 0 0 1 0-16z"
fill="url(#g)"
/>
<linearGradient
id="h"
x1="-11.875"
x2="-11.875"
y1="619.958"
y2="557.955"
gradientTransform="matrix(8 0 0 -8 455 4941)"
gradientUnits="userSpaceOnUse"
>
<stop offset="0" stop-color="#fff33b" />
<stop offset=".04" stop-color="#fee72e" />
<stop offset=".117" stop-color="#fed51b" />
<stop offset=".196" stop-color="#fdca10" />
<stop offset=".281" stop-color="#fdc70c" />
<stop offset=".669" stop-color="#f3903f" />
<stop offset=".888" stop-color="#ed683c" />
<stop offset="1" stop-color="#e93e3a" />
</linearGradient>
<path
d="M360 80c13.255 0 24-10.745 24-24s-10.745-24-24-24-24 10.745-24 24 10.745 24 24 24zm0-32a8 8 0 1 1 0 16 8 8 0 0 1 0-16z"
fill="url(#h)"
/>
<linearGradient
id="i"
x1="-11.875"
x2="-11.875"
y1="619.958"
y2="557.955"
gradientTransform="matrix(8 0 0 -8 455 4941)"
gradientUnits="userSpaceOnUse"
>
<stop offset="0" stop-color="#fff33b" />
<stop offset=".04" stop-color="#fee72e" />
<stop offset=".117" stop-color="#fed51b" />
<stop offset=".196" stop-color="#fdca10" />
<stop offset=".281" stop-color="#fdc70c" />
<stop offset=".669" stop-color="#f3903f" />
<stop offset=".888" stop-color="#ed683c" />
<stop offset="1" stop-color="#e93e3a" />
</linearGradient>
<path
d="M360 400c-13.255 0-24 10.745-24 24s10.745 24 24 24 24-10.745 24-24-10.745-24-24-24zm0 32a8 8 0 1 1 0-16 8 8 0 0 1 0 16z"
fill="url(#i)"
/>
<linearGradient
id="j"
x1="-41.875"
x2="-41.875"
y1="619.958"
y2="557.955"
gradientTransform="matrix(8 0 0 -8 455 4941)"
gradientUnits="userSpaceOnUse"
>
<stop offset="0" stop-color="#fff33b" />
<stop offset=".04" stop-color="#fee72e" />
<stop offset=".117" stop-color="#fed51b" />
<stop offset=".196" stop-color="#fdca10" />
<stop offset=".281" stop-color="#fdc70c" />
<stop offset=".669" stop-color="#f3903f" />
<stop offset=".888" stop-color="#ed683c" />
<stop offset="1" stop-color="#e93e3a" />
</linearGradient>
<path
d="M120 448c13.255 0 24-10.745 24-24s-10.745-24-24-24-24 10.745-24 24 10.745 24 24 24zm0-32a8 8 0 1 1 0 16 8 8 0 0 1 0-16z"
fill="url(#j)"
/>
<linearGradient
id="k"
x1="-26.875"
x2="-26.875"
y1="619.958"
y2="557.955"
gradientTransform="matrix(8 0 0 -8 455 4941)"
gradientUnits="userSpaceOnUse"
>
<stop offset="0" stop-color="#fff33b" />
<stop offset=".04" stop-color="#fee72e" />
<stop offset=".117" stop-color="#fed51b" />
<stop offset=".196" stop-color="#fdca10" />
<stop offset=".281" stop-color="#fdc70c" />
<stop offset=".669" stop-color="#f3903f" />
<stop offset=".888" stop-color="#ed683c" />
<stop offset="1" stop-color="#e93e3a" />
</linearGradient>
<path
d="M184 88h112a8 8 0 0 0 8-8V48a8 8 0 0 0-8-8H184a8 8 0 0 0-8 8v32a8 8 0 0 0 8 8zm8-32h96v16h-96V56z"
fill="url(#k)"
/>
</svg>
More icons in the same style and category